During the Paleolithic and Mesolithic periods, women played crucial roles in their communities, primarily as gatherers, which complemented the hunting activities of men. They were responsible for foraging for plant foods, nuts, seeds, and other resources, contributing significantly to the diet and sustenance of their groups. Additionally, women likely participated in childcare and social organization, fostering community bonds and cultural continuity. Their roles were essential for survival and the development of early human societies.
